5. Nissan Armada/Infiniti QX80
Nissan completely revised its Armada for 2017. Previously set on a chassis similar to that of the Titan pickup (which has also just been revamped), it’s now based on the Patrol, a full-size Japanese SUV that has never been sold in North America. It’s worth noting that Nissan is using a formula previously applied to the more luxurious QX80. This means that, esthetic differences aside, the new Armada and the QX80 are virtually twins. The only available engine is a V8 gasoline engine able to produce 390 HP (400 HP for the QX80), while for both models maximum towing capacity comes in at 8,500 lbs.
